Should You Buy a 1987 Toyota Cressida?

The 1987 Toyota Cressida is a classic sedan that combines reliability with a touch of luxury. With a rear-wheel-drive layout and a 2.8L V6 engine producing 135 hp and 170 lb-ft of torque, it offers a smooth driving experience that appeals to those who appreciate a well-engineered vehicle. The 5-speed manual transmission adds a layer of engagement for driving enthusiasts, making it a fun choice for both daily commuting and weekend drives. While specific MPG figures and MSRP are not available, the Cressida is known for its fuel efficiency relative to its class, typically running on regular unleaded fuel.

As a vehicle that has stood the test of time, the Cressida is often sought after by collectors and enthusiasts alike. Its blend of comfort, performance, and Toyota's renowned reliability makes it a compelling option for those looking for a classic sedan that doesn't compromise on quality or driving enjoyment.

Known Issues (NHTSA Data)

No significant NHTSA complaints on record. However, like many older vehicles, potential buyers should be aware of common issues related to age, such as rust, wear on suspension components, and electrical gremlins. Regular maintenance and thorough inspections are recommended to ensure longevity.
